An SBA 504 loan is a specialized program designed for small businesses that need to purchase major fixed assets, such as real estate, buildings, or heavy machinery. This type of financing typically involves a partnership between a certified development company and a private lender. It is a smart move when you need to expand your operations or upgrade your physical facilities.

The requirements for an SBA loan in Sacramento generally include being a for-profit business, meeting SBA size standards, and having a clear business purpose for the loan. Affordable SBA loans in Sacramento are characterized by competitive interest rates, often lower than conventional loans, and favorable repayment terms.
